Definition of "Eccles"

Eccles

/ˈɛkəlz/
  • proper noun

    1. A town in Salford, Greater Manchester, England.  

    2. A village in Aylesford parish, Tonbridge and Malling district, Kent, England (OS grid ref TQ7260).  

    3. A village north-east of Kelso, Berwickshire, Scottish Borders council area, Scotland (OS grid ref NT7641).  

    4. A commune in Nord department, Hauts-de-France, France.  

    5. A census-designated place in Raleigh County, West Virginia, United States, originally named Ecclesiastes.  

    6. A surname.
